View previous topic :: View next topic |
Author |
Message |
data_come n00b
Joined: 04 May 2013 Posts: 3 Location: china
|
Posted: Sun Jun 09, 2013 5:19 am Post subject: 为什么我连本地loopback 程序延时反而变大 |
|
|
client/front/server:
client:centos 6.3
front: gentoo-liveDVD 10.1
server: gentoo 20121221
3台均为hp 380G8/1*E5-2643 3.3G 4core/32G mem/broad
client---front---server ,front/server分别会返回client两个时间戳:t1/t2, 正常模式:t1/t2 =1.2ms/2.2ms
因为client/front 程序压力比较小,cpu 都在0.3%,内存利用率也很低,client--front之间的数据量不大,
现将client放到front上, 程序直接连 127.0.0.1:tcp port
按道理 client/front 在同一台机,缩小的网络延时,t1将降低,但实测发现
t1/t2=1.5/2.7ms
为什么,有什么方法也检查原因?
请大师指教 |
|
Back to top |
|
|
druggo Apprentice
Joined: 24 Sep 2003 Posts: 289 Location: Hangzhou, China
|
Posted: Wed Jun 12, 2013 2:30 am Post subject: |
|
|
直接抓包分析,看时间消耗在哪里了。 _________________ HighWayToHell(blog)
http://blog.druggo.org/ |
|
Back to top |
|
|
data_come n00b
Joined: 04 May 2013 Posts: 3 Location: china
|
Posted: Thu Jun 20, 2013 4:30 pm Post subject: |
|
|
sniffer仅能看出 时延扩电,看到的仅是结果呀 |
|
Back to top |
|
|
|